Understanding TDSB Snow Days: Decision-Making Processes and Impacts

Image
Introduction In Toronto, winter often brings severe weather conditions, including heavy snowfall and extreme cold. These conditions can disrupt daily routines, particularly for students and staff of the Toronto District School Board (TDSB). Understanding how the TDSB manages snow days provides insight into the decision-making processes that prioritize safety and minimize educational disruptions. TDSB's Decision-Making Process for Snow Days The TDSB has established procedures to assess and respond to severe weather conditions. Early in the morning, a team comprising the Director, Associate Directors, transportation, and communications staff evaluates various factors, including current and forecasted weather conditions and road safety. This collaborative approach ensures that decisions are well-informed and prioritize the safety of students and staff.
